Prepared for heads of department ahead of Thursday's session. The Orvandel platform team is requesting a 14% increase to next year's infrastructure budget, driven primarily by capacity needs for the Skylark rollout and deferred hardware refresh in the Tarnwick facility. The request has been vetted by finance; two scenarios — full funding and a phased alternative — are attached for comparison. Department heads should come prepared to rank their dependent initiatives. The underlying business direction that justifies this request appears below.

management briefing: Jorixax Holdings is in early talks to buy Casixax Holdings for about $420.3 million. The Fenmir launch date is October 27, and nothing goes to the press before then. Legal wants the Keloxek Foods term sheet redrafted before April 16.

## Dovetail environments

Heads up for the sync: date localization now happens server-side in Dovetail, so each environment carries its own locale bundle version. Staging is pinned one bundle ahead of prod so we catch weird formats (looking at you, week-numbering edge cases) before users do. If dates look off in a preview env, check the bundle pin before blaming the renderer — it's almost always the pin. Each environment's locale and formatting settings are captured below.

settings of kagag-kagef:
[kelath]
port = 9300
region = west-4
host = kelath.olvarqworks.example
team = sorion
timeout_ms = 1000
retries = 8

## Invoice Renderer — Quick Notes

The Paperquill renderer pulls line items, rasterizes the template, and stamps totals last — don't reorder those steps or footers break. Fonts are vendored; never fetch at runtime. If output looks wrong, check the render queue table first, which lives in the database at the connection string below.

primary connection of yagep-kahip = redis://giliel_svc:zYiKsLL2PLpfPL@db-348f.xolmarsys.corp:5432/fenwyn